Types of Exercise Bikes
When thinking about an exercise bike, it's vital to know the various types available. Here's a breakdown of the main types of exercise bikes, each with its special features and advantages.
| Type of Exercise Bike | Description | Advantages |
|---|---|---|
| Upright Bikes | These resemble standard bicycles, with the rider sitting upright. | Great for cardio exercises; compact design; normally cheaper. |
| Recumbent Bikes | Include a bigger seat with back assistance and a reclined position for comfort. | More comfy for longer exercises; better for people with back issues. |
| Spin Bikes | Developed for high-intensity indoor cycling, including a heavy flywheel and adjustable resistance. | Ideal for intense cardio sessions; mimics genuine cycling; typically used in group classes. |
| Hybrid Bikes | Integrate features of upright and recumbent bikes, using versatility. | Appropriate for numerous exercises; adjustable seating position. |
| Air Bikes | Make use of a fan for resistance, making the exercise challenging as effort boosts. | Full-body exercise; exceptional for high-intensity period training (HIIT). |
Advantages of Using an Exercise Bike
Including a stationary bicycle into your physical fitness regimen can yield various benefits. Here's a list of key advantages:
- Improved Cardiovascular Health: Regular use can reinforce the heart and lungs, enhancing general cardiovascular fitness.
- Low-Impact Exercise: Unlike running, cycling puts less pressure on the joints, making it perfect for individuals with joint concerns or those recovering from injuries.
- Weight reduction: Combining cycling with a healthy diet can lead to efficient weight reduction and fat burning.
- Convenience: Exercise bikes allow users to work out at home, making it much easier to fit exercise into a busy way of life.
- Customizable Workouts: Most bikes feature adjustable resistance levels, allowing users to tailor their workouts according to their fitness levels and goals.
- Enhanced Lower Body Strength: Cycling mainly targets the muscles in the legs, improving strength and endurance.
- Mental Health Benefits: Regular exercise has been linked to decreased anxiety and depression, adding to improved state of mind and tension relief.
Key Features to Consider When Shopping for an Exercise Bike
When picking a stationary bicycle, it's crucial to think about different features that can boost your exercise experience. Here are some aspects to search for:
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Resistance Levels | Search for bikes with adjustable resistance to increase or decrease workout strength. |
| Comfy Seat | A well-padded, adjustable seat can prevent pain during long rides. |
| Handlebars | Ergonomically created handlebars can improve grip and convenience. |
| Digital Display | A screen that reveals metrics like speed, distance, time, and calories burned can assist track development. |
| Built-in Workouts | Some bikes feature predefined exercise programs or Bluetooth connectivity for app combination. |
| Mobility | Lightweight models with wheels make it simpler to move and keep the bike. |
| Stability and Durability | Look for a strong frame that can endure extreme exercises over time. |
Tips for Using an Exercise Bike Effectively
To optimize your exercises and guarantee you get the most out of your exercise bike, consider the following suggestions:
- Proper Setup: Adjust the seat height so that your legs can extend fully without locking your knees at the bottom of the pedal stroke.
- Warm-Up: Always begin with a 5-10 minute warm-up at low intensity to prepare your muscles.
- Engage Core Muscles: Keep your core engaged while biking to enhance stability and posture.
- Vary Intensity: Switch in between moderate and high-intensity intervals to challenge your body and keep exercises exciting.
- Stay Hydrated: Keep water within reach and beverage routinely to stay hydrated throughout your workout.
- Cool off and Stretch: After your exercise, take a couple of minutes to cool off and stretch to prevent discomfort.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Exercise Bikes
1. The length of time should I ride a stationary bicycle?
- Go for a minimum of 30 minutes of moderate-intensity riding most days of the week for optimum health advantages.
2. Can stationary bicycle aid with weight loss?
- Yes, combined with an appropriate diet plan, routine biking can assist burn calories and promote weight-loss.
3. Are stationary bicycle suitable for beginners?
- Absolutely! Exercise bikes are user-friendly and can be adjusted for different physical fitness levels.
4. How do I keep my stationary bicycle?
- Regularly look for loose bolts, clean the frame and seat, and lube the chain or flywheel as required.
5. Should I select a recumbent or upright bike?
- Pick a recumbent bike if you prefer convenience and back support; select an upright bike for a more conventional biking experience.
